Output 86ef77c6317d783cfdfdee05ab235279e87201f4e918f8ef7be8d0d4bd334aa3:0

value
12673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24841c5b7e484ae7afcf3d171eae6a1b27870bf OP_EQUAL
address
3LrtPKvtWyvzzqXnT6acjS9zUXp4NhUNca
transaction
86ef77c6317d783cfdfdee05ab235279e87201f4e918f8ef7be8d0d4bd334aa3
confirmations
354198
spent
true